254 lines
5.2 KiB
JavaScript
254 lines
5.2 KiB
JavaScript
import request from '@/utils/request'
|
|
|
|
// 获取资源利用率班组人员管理列表
|
|
export function getResourceUseTeamListA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/list',
|
|
method: 'get',
|
|
params: data,
|
|
})
|
|
}
|
|
|
|
// 新增资源利用率班组人员
|
|
export function addResourceUseTeamA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/addData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 编辑资源利用率班组人员
|
|
export function editResourceUseTeamA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/updateData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 删除资源利用率班组人员
|
|
export function deleteResourceUseTeamA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/delete',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 获取资源利用率大型设备管理列表
|
|
export function getResourceUseDeviceListA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/getMaxDevList',
|
|
method: 'get',
|
|
params: data,
|
|
})
|
|
}
|
|
|
|
// 新增资源利用率大型设备管理
|
|
export function addResourceUseDeviceA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/addMaxDevData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 编辑资源利用率大型设备管理
|
|
export function editResourceUseDeviceA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/updateMaxDevData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 删除资源利用率大型设备管理
|
|
export function deleteResourceUseDeviceA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/delMaxDevData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 获取班组人数列表数据
|
|
export function getResourceUseTeamCountListA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/userList',
|
|
method: 'get',
|
|
params: data,
|
|
})
|
|
}
|
|
|
|
// 新增班组人数
|
|
export function addResourceUseTeamCountA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/addUserData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 编辑班组人数
|
|
export function editResourceUseTeamCountA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/updateUserData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 删除班组人数
|
|
export function deleteResourceUseTeamCountA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/delUser',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 获取到岗人数列表数据
|
|
export function getResourceUseOnDutyListA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/getOnDutyList',
|
|
method: 'get',
|
|
params: data,
|
|
})
|
|
}
|
|
|
|
// 获取没有到岗的人员列表
|
|
export function getResourceUseNoDutyListA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/getNoDutyList',
|
|
method: 'get',
|
|
params: data,
|
|
})
|
|
}
|
|
|
|
// 提交到岗人数
|
|
export function submitResourceUseOnDutyA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/addOnDutyUser',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 删除到岗人数
|
|
export function deleteResourceUseOnDutyA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/delOnDuty',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 获取设备使用记录列表
|
|
export function getDeviceUseRecordListA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/getDevUsedList',
|
|
method: 'get',
|
|
params: data,
|
|
})
|
|
}
|
|
|
|
// 新增设备使用记录
|
|
export function addDeviceUseRecordA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/addDevUsedData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 编辑设备使用记录
|
|
export function editDeviceUseRecordA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/updateDevUsedData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 删除设备使用记录
|
|
export function deleteDeviceUseRecordA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/delDevUsedData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 获取设备故障记录列表
|
|
export function getDeviceFaultRecordListA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/getFaultList',
|
|
method: 'get',
|
|
params: data,
|
|
})
|
|
}
|
|
|
|
// 新增设备故障记录
|
|
export function addDeviceFaultRecordA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/addFaultData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 编辑设备故障记录
|
|
export function editDeviceFaultRecordA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/updateFaultData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 删除设备故障记录
|
|
export function deleteDeviceFaultRecordA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/delFaultData',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 获取分析提醒列表
|
|
export function getAnalysisReminderListA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/getAsyncWarnList',
|
|
method: 'get',
|
|
params: data,
|
|
})
|
|
}
|
|
|
|
// 新增分析提醒
|
|
export function addAnalysisReminderA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/addAsyncWarnList',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 编辑分析提醒
|
|
export function editAnalysisReminderA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/updateAsyncWarnList',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|
|
|
|
// 删除分析提醒
|
|
export function deleteAnalysisReminderAPI(data) {
|
|
return request({
|
|
url: '/background/sj/workTeam/delAsyncWarnList',
|
|
method: 'post',
|
|
data,
|
|
})
|
|
}
|